DRY STIR-FRY SEASONING MIX



Dry Stir-Fry Seasoning Mix image

Time 5m

Yield 10 tablespoons, 10 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 8

1/4 cup chicken bouillon
3 tablespoons cornstarch
2 tablespoons sugar
2 tablespoons dried minced onions
2 tablespoons instant garlic, minced
2 teaspoons dried parsley
1/2 teaspoon ground ginger
1/4 teaspoon crushed red bell pepper (dried)

Steps:

  • In a small bowl, stir bouillon granules, cornstarch, sugar, onion, garlic, parsley, ginger and red pepper until blended.
  • Store in an airtight container in a cool place.
  • Stir mixture before measuring.
  • Use like any dry stir-fry mix.
  • 1 tablespoon equals one packet.

STIR-FRY SEASONING MIX



Stir-Fry Seasoning Mix image

Number Of Ingredients 9

You Will Need:
1/4 cup chicken bouillon
3 tablespoons cornstarch
2 tablespoons sugar
2 tablespoons dried minced onion
2 teaspoons garlic instant minced
2 teaspoons parsley dried
1/2 teaspoon ginger ground
1/4 teaspoon red bell pepper crushed

Steps:

  • Instructions:In a small bowl, stir bouillon granules, cornstarch, sugar, onion, garlic, parsley, ginger and red pepper until blended. Store in an airtight container in a cool place. Include directions for use.To Use: Stir mixture before measuring. In a small bowl, stir 1 tablespoon of the dried mixture into 1/4 cup water or dry sherry. Let stand for 3 to 5 minutes to moisten the dried vegetables. Stir-fry 2 cups raw vegetables over medium-high heat until crisp-tender. Stir seasoning liquid, pour over vegetables. Stirring, bring to a boil and boil for 1 minute or until thickened and mixture coats vegetables.
